To create a persuasive written argument
The modules give the learner the techniques to be able to write with an influential voice and to develop robust arguments with logic and cohesion.
Sessions for Strategic Language Skills
Recommended total number of lessons is 15 lessons (5 modules each of 3 lessons).
All 5 modules form a programme of 15 hours which gives the learner the ability to create persuasive written arguments.
-
Practice in the skill of crafting a written text (such as a short summary, a long-form essay, a piece of descriptive text) which succeeds in communicating the writer's point of view with clarity and style.
The ability to take command of the written language and use it to either present information, express opinion or to engage a reader elevates the learner's opportunity to communicate and be understood.
Course Content
Module 1 - Advanced grammar review
– Writing and speaking exercises under
timed conditions
– Comprehension tasks with an unfamiliar
text
Module 2 - Vocabulary
– Creative writing tasks to develop a wide
vocabulary
– Word origins and meanings
Module 3 - Essay writing
– Practice in the structure of essay writing
(or a long text)
– Techniques to present the main topics
with clarity
– Synthesising ideas
Module 4 - Copywriting
– Practice in copy editing from long form
to short form
– Tasks for writing advertising copy
– Practice in journalism
Module 5 - Style
– Literary Critical Analysis to discuss the
style of the authors
– Adding sophistication
– Poetic devices
– Exercises to practise change of style
across a variety of writing tasks
